Iguatemi in Winter
In winter (June, July and August), Iguatemi sees average daytime highs around 23°C and overnight lows near 13°C, with 142 mm of rain over about 16 wet days across the season. It is the coldest season of the year and the driest season of the year.
Over the season highs climb from about 22°C in early June to 24°C by late August.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 46% of the time across winter, and the air most often feels dry.

Temperature in Iguatemi in Winter
Over the season highs climb from about 22°C in early June to 24°C by late August.
A typical winter day in Iguatemi reaches about 23°C and drops to 13°C overnight. The warmest of the three months is August, the coolest July.
Iguatemi weather by month
How the three winter months (June, July and August) compare with the rest of the year — the season's months are highlighted.
| Month | High / Low (°C) | Rainfall (mm) | Wet days | Daylight (hours) | Travel score |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Jan | 27° / 19° | 232 | 23.8 | 13.3 | 4.3 |
| Feb | 28° / 19° | 179 | 20.2 | 12.8 | 4.5 |
| Mar | 27° / 19° | 154 | 20.1 | 12.2 | 5.0 |
| Apr | 25° / 17° | 64 | 10.7 | 11.5 | 6.6 |
| May | 23° / 14° | 64 | 7.8 | 10.9 | 7.1 |
| Jun | 22° / 13° | 47 | 5.6 | 10.6 | 7.5 |
| Jul | 22° / 12° | 54 | 5.6 | 10.7 | 7.5 |
| Aug | 23° / 13° | 40 | 5.2 | 11.2 | 7.8 |
| Sep | 24° / 15° | 90 | 9.8 | 11.9 | 6.9 |
| Oct | 25° / 16° | 116 | 14.7 | 12.6 | 5.9 |
| Nov | 25° / 17° | 152 | 16.8 | 13.1 | 5.4 |
| Dec | 27° / 18° | 181 | 20.9 | 13.4 | 4.8 |

Air quality in Iguatemi in Winter
Average fine-particle pollution (PM2.5) through the year — so you can see where winter falls, not just the annual average.
Air quality in Iguatemi is worst in June — around 71 µg/m³ PM2.5 (unhealthy), about 2.3× the cleanest month (December, 31 µg/m³).
Modeled monthly averages (CAMS reanalysis, 2015–2024).

Where is Iguatemi?
Iguatemi sits at 23.6°S, 46.4°W, 824 m above sea level, in Brazil. The nearest listed city is Sao Rafael, 3.0 km away.
Topography around Iguatemi
How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Iguatemi.
Within 3 km, the terrain around Iguatemi has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 224 m around an average of 836 m above sea level; within 16 km, signific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 336 m; within 80 km, very signific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 1,708 m.
The land around Iguatemi is covered by artificial surfaces (45%) and trees (36%) within 3 km, artificial surfaces (55%) and trees (32%) within 16 km, and trees (52%) and water (21%) within 80 km.
